Taxonomy Tree
| Kingdom | Organic compounds |
|---|---|
| Superclass | Benzenoids |
| Class | Fluorenes |
| Subclass | Not available |
| Intermediate Tree Nodes | Not available |
| Direct Parent | Fluorenes |
| Alternative Parents | Alpha amino acids and derivatives Carbocyclic fatty acids Carbamate esters Organic carbonic acids and derivatives Monocarboxylic acids and derivatives Carboxylic acids Organopnictogen compounds Organonitrogen compounds Organic oxides Hydrocarbon derivatives Carbonyl compounds |
| Molecular Framework | Aromatic homopolycyclic compounds |
| Substituents | Fluorene - Alpha-amino acid or derivatives - Carbocyclic fatty acid - Fatty acyl - Carbamic acid ester - Carbonic acid derivative - Carboxylic acid derivative - Carboxylic acid - Monocarboxylic acid or derivatives - Organic nitrogen compound - Organonitrogen compound - Organooxygen compound - Hydrocarbon derivative - Organic oxide - Organopnictogen compound - Carbonyl group - Organic oxygen compound - Aromatic homopolycyclic compound |
| Description | This compound belongs to the class of organic compounds known as fluorenes. These are compounds containing a fluorene moiety, which consists of two benzene rings connected through either a cyclopentane, cyclopentene, or cyclopenta-1,3-diene. |

| Sensitivity | Air & Heat sensitive |
|---|---|
| Molecular Weight | 393.500 g/mol |
| XLogP3 | 5.800 |
| Hydrogen Bond Donor Count | 2 |
| Hydrogen Bond Acceptor Count | 4 |
| Rotatable Bond Count | 7 |
| Exact Mass | 393.194 Da |
| Monoisotopic Mass | 393.194 Da |
| Topological Polar Surface Area | 75.600 Ų |
| Heavy Atom Count | 29 |
| Formal Charge | 0 |
| Complexity | 551.000 |
| Isotope Atom Count | 0 |
| Defined Atom Stereocenter Count | 1 |
| Undefined Atom Stereocenter Count | 0 |
| Defined Bond Stereocenter Count | 0 |
| Undefined Bond Stereocenter Count | 0 |
| The total count of all stereochemical bonds | 0 |
| Covalently-Bonded Unit Count | 1 |
